Unfortunately I cannot recommend Hotchkiss. I had a noise on my car and they gave me a quote of $2.2k for front struts, tie rods, and engine mounts, which I had to decline (for a second estimate and to fly home for Thanksgiving). After declining and picking up my car, they emailed me a "waiver" later that night to sign (which I didn't) that mentioned front wheel bearing assemblies (NOT in original estimate), tie rods (NO struts), and engine mounts. Once I got home from the holiday, I took my car to Famous Auto Repair (the mechanic used by the business I bought my car from) and they agreed my front wheel bearing assemblies needed replacing ($500 total), but said the other things were fine (maybe not perfect, but not a "safety concern" as Hotchkiss said - I realize Hotchkiss's threshold for repair may be lower, but come on). This fixed the noise immediately. So, if I had agreed to Hotchkiss's initial estimate, I would have paid over 2 grand and not gotten my problem fixed. I'm giving 2 stars instead of 1 because overall the workers were professional and the manager reached out afterwards to ask if I had any feedback, but I cannot recommend this shop if you want an honest and affordable assessment of what you need to get fixed to remedy an issue you're having (not just a laundry list of nice-to-haves).
